My Buying Guides on Portable Toilet Blue Liquid
What I Look for First
When I buy portable toilet blue liquid, I first check whether it is meant for the exact type of toilet I use. I make sure it is suitable for camping toilets, RV toilets, or portable chemical toilets. I also look at how well it controls odor, breaks down waste, and keeps the tank clean. For me, these are the main things that decide whether a product is worth buying.
Odor Control Matters Most
In my experience, the biggest reason to use blue liquid is to stop bad smells. I prefer products that promise strong deodorizing power and work quickly after use. If a product does not control odor well, I find it frustrating no matter how cheap it is.
Waste Breakdown and Tank Cleaning
I always check if the liquid helps break down solid waste and toilet paper. This makes emptying the tank much easier and cleaner. I also like formulas that reduce buildup inside the tank, because that helps keep the toilet fresher for longer.
Size and Concentration
I pay attention to whether the product is concentrated or ready to use. Concentrated formulas usually last longer and give better value, while ready-to-use options are simpler and more convenient. I choose based on how often I travel and how much storage space I have.
Compatibility with My Toilet System
Not every blue liquid works with every portable toilet. I always read the label to make sure it is safe for plastic tanks, seals, and valves. I avoid products that might damage parts or leave residue behind.
Eco-Friendliness and Safety
I prefer products that are biodegradable and less harsh on the environment. Since I often use portable toilets outdoors, I like knowing the formula is safer for disposal where allowed. I also check whether it has a strong chemical smell or if it is gentler to handle.
Ease of Use
For me, a good blue liquid should be easy to measure and pour without making a mess. I like bottles with clear instructions and simple dosing caps. This saves time and makes the whole process less unpleasant.
Price and Value
I do not always choose the cheapest option. Instead, I look at how much liquid I get, how concentrated it is, and how long it lasts. A slightly more expensive product can be a better deal if it works better and needs less per use.
